What is CRM Marketing: Definition and Benefits

Customer Relationship Management (CRM) marketing is a strategy built around customer data. It centralizes every interaction, personalizes messaging, and coordinates sales and marketing activity across every touchpoint so teams can create relevant, revenue-producing experiences.

Personalized Customer Experiences

Industry benchmarks show targeted CRM marketing programs lift response rates by double digits because every email, SMS, or ad references real behavior. With centralized data such as purchase history, communication preferences, and interaction logs, marketers can send cold email marketing campaigns that feel bespoke, keep brands off blacklists, and accelerate the first reply.

Enhanced Lead Management

Segmentation, lead scoring, and dynamic routing help teams prioritize the most qualified accounts. Sales can organize prospects by industry, tech stack, past engagement, or readiness to buy, letting SDRs focus effort on high-potential deals instead of spreadsheets. The faster you nudge interested contacts forward, the shorter the sales cycle.

Data-Driven Decision Making

Sales has always been iterative. Modern CRM marketing strategy captures channel performance, campaign cost, and buyer signals in one analytics layer so leaders can see which offers convert, what cadence length works best, and where to reinvest budget. Clean, normalized data unlocks accurate forecasting and immediate pivots as markets shift.

Automated Communication

CRM platforms plug into email, SMS, push, and telephony systems so teams can design trigger-based email marketing flows for every scenario. Post-purchase surveys, dormant account nudges, and abandoned-cart reminders go out automatically, giving prospects the right guidance at the right time without manual follow-up.

Improved Customer Retention

Winning new customers is expensive; retaining them increases ACV (annual contract value) while stabilizing revenue. CRM marketing makes it simple to identify churn risks, send usage tips to inactive SaaS accounts, or surface cross-sell recommendations the moment a customer browses a new product line. Every subscription feels supported, so no customer falls through the cracks.

Which Channels Are Best for CRM Marketing?

Opt-in CRM marketing is powerful when each channel respects customer preferences and timing. Pairing accurate CRM data with the right medium ensures prospects receive practical help, not noise.

Email Marketing

Email remains the most controllable CRM marketing channel. Use welcome flows, win-back series, renewal reminders, and one-to-one cold email marketing outreach that references recent activity. For example, a cybersecurity vendor can send a tailored case study to finance leads who clicked on compliance content, improving credibility and reply rates.

SMS (Text Messaging)

SMS is instant, so reserve it for urgent, time-sensitive nudges. Service businesses send automated appointment reminders; SaaS teams confirm demos with mobile links that update the CRM when recipients reply. Every message should be opt-in and concise to respect privacy regulations.

Social Media Channels

Connect social profiles to your CRM to capture mentions, DMs, and engagement data. A retail brand can monitor Instagram comments, route hot questions to sales, and reward loyal fans with exclusive discount codes sent via direct message. Chatbots can answer FAQs while logging every interaction for future personalization.

Push Notifications

Push notifications keep mobile shoppers, travelers, or subscribers engaged. Notify customers when a wishlist item goes on sale, launch a cross-sell recommendation triggered by browsing behavior, or promote app-only deals. Because push is interruption-based, align each notification with a clear benefit and an easy next step.

Live Chat and Chatbots

Studies consistently show the first team to respond often wins the deal. Live chat and AI chatbots allow prospects to ask questions about pricing, inventory, or onboarding and receive help instantly. Every transcript syncs to the CRM so reps can follow up with context rather than guesswork.

In-App Messaging

In-app messaging speaks to users while they are in the product. SaaS brands use it to spotlight unused features, share onboarding milestones, or invite high-usage accounts into beta programs. These nudges shorten the time-to-value metric and keep adoption high.

Phone Calls

Phone calls still matter when stakes are high or workflows are complex. Instead of cold-calling blindly, CRM marketing data highlights which accounts are sales-ready, making discovery calls purposeful. Combine call notes with email cadences and SMS reminders to create a multi-touch cadence that respects buyer time.
